  1. Jan 1, 1993 · Jean Thesman. 3.86. 79 ratings4 reviews. Molly Donnelly faces many changes in Seattle during the turbulent years of World War II. Her best friend is taken away to a Japanese internment camp, her mother gets her first job in a factory, and Molly herself discovers first love.   6. Apr 1, 1993 · MOLLY DONNELLY. by Jean Thesman ‧ RELEASE DATE: April 1, 1993. The author of several well-plotted if melodramatic novels (The Rain Catchers, 1991) uses the straightforward narration of a young Irish-American as a framework for depicting the WW II years in Seattle.

Written for younger teen readers (6th-9th grade), Molly Donnelly by Jean Thesman chronicles the life of a young Irish American girl from ages 12 through 16 during World War II in Seattle, Washington. Serving as a subplot of the novel, one of Molly's best friends is her next door neighbor, Emily Tanaka, who along with her family is sent to an ...
